9 EMC Information

Your battery pack has been designed to meet EMC standards throughout its service life
without additional maintenance. There is always an opportunity to relocate your battery
pack within an environment that contains therapy devices with their own unknown EMC
behavior. If you believe your battery pack is affected by locating it closer to a therapy
device, simply separate the battery pack and the therapy device to remove the condition.
Pressure Output
The battery pack is designed to provide power to your therapy device. If you suspect the
pressure output is affected by EMC interference, relocate the therapy device to another
area. If performance continues to be affected, discontinue use and contact your home
care provider.

Emission of Radio Frequency Energy
RTCA/DO-160G Section 21
Notes:
(1) The battery pack uses the therapy device supplied ac/dc adapter for charging and does not connect directly
to the ac mains. The presence of the battery pack in the connection does not affect overall compliance status.
